Flower Mound, Texas – July, 2009:

Keeping with our commitment to make our clients aware of industry changes, we are providing you an update regarding recent price developments in the paper industry. The economic downturn has impacted every aspect of business, and the printing and paper industry is no exception.

Starting in July, the price of newsprint grade (uncoated papers) will be decreased. This decrease applies to formats that use 2.7# newsprint and 30# HB65. All Ivie clients currently using these papers should see the effects of this change as soon as the reduction occurs.

Based on our experience and continued analysis of the market, we believe prices will continue to decline. Although nothing has been announced, with demand down nearly 30% from last year, we expect coated paper pricing will follow the uncoated trend in the near future.
